Last night in the NBA: Clippers, devoid of a big-name player, beat a Warriors team with stars to spare

The Clippers are devoid of a true star, a prerequisite for winning in the NBA playoffs, and they’ve got players on their roster with pasts full of injuries. But those are tomorrow’s problems. The present is pretty fun.

The Clippers won their second-straight game over elite NBA teams, beating the best of the best, the Golden State Warriors, Monday night at Staples.

Sure, the Warriors didn’t have Steph Curry, but the Warriors still had the three best players in the game wearing their latest alternate jersey. And the Clippers weathered a Klay Thompson flurry late in the fourth quarter, keeping their composure until they put the game away in overtime.
